(Douglas).- The award highlights Altenar’s people-first approach, built around transparent leadership, structured career development, flexible working policies, and initiatives designed to strengthen collaboration across its European offices.
Recognition for Employee-Centered Culture
Sportsbook provider Altenar has been named “Best Workplace” at the SiGMA Europe Awards, recognising the company’s continued investment in employee wellbeing, professional development, and workplace culture across its international teams.
Strong Growth and Talent Attraction
During 2025, Altenar achieved company growth of 34.5%, while its overall offer acceptance rate increased by 22% to reach 85%, reflecting the company’s growing reputation in the highly competitive iGaming talent market.
The company has continued to invest heavily in employee engagement through leadership training programmes, internal recognition initiatives, upgraded communication infrastructure, relocation support, private health insurance, hybrid work options, and company-wide wellbeing initiatives.
Expanding Employee Engagement Initiatives
In 2025, Altenar expanded employee recognition channels and gamification initiatives designed to improve communication and team engagement. Enhanced relocation and team event policies have further strengthened cross-border collaboration.
Ekaterina Firsova, HR Director at Altenar, commented: “At Altenar, we strongly believe that long-term success starts with people. Creating an environment where employees feel supported, valued, and empowered to grow professionally is central to our strategy. We are proud of the collaborative culture our teams have built together and remain committed to investing in our people as the company continues to grow globally.”
Continued Expansion Across Regulated Markets
Alongside strengthening its internal culture and expanding its international teams, Altenar continues to grow as a sportsbook provider across regulated European markets, supporting operators with flexible and scalable technology solutions.
One of the strongest examples is the company’s partnership with Jokerbet in Spain, where Altenar helped enhance the brand’s sportsbook offering through improved promotional tools, Bet Builder functionality, and the launch of eFootball, contributing to more predictable revenue streams and increased margins.
